Sr. Product Manager - San Francisco, United States - Authentic8
Description
We are a leading cybersecurity company with multiple offices (San Francisco and Redwood City, CA; Herndon, VA; and Washington, D.C.) working to fundamentally disrupt the way organizations deliver and access the web, as well as conduct digital investigations.
More than 700 government agencies and commercial enterprises trust Authentic8's 100% cloud-native, Silo Web Isolation Platform to protect their most at-risk data and missions.
Silo is designed ground-up with zero-trust principles, delivered via globally-scaled infrastructure, and configurable to solve a wide range of security challenges.
Our flagship product, Silo for Research, is the market-leading solution for conducting secure and anonymous digital investigations and intelligence work across the surface, deep and dark web.
We have an immediate opening for a Sr.Product Manager, located in any of:
San Francisco, CA, Redwood City, CA, Washington, DC or Toronto, Canada.
This is an impactful PM role that offers ownership over our web security portfolio, as well as components of our broader platform, including our admin interfaces and APIs.
Those would be your "majors", but everyone on our team has "minors" and pitches in as needed. This role will allow you to flex both your inbound and your outbound PM muscles.You'll be acting as a hub between engineering, marketing, sales and customers.
You will drive success of the product portfolio by executing the product strategy and enabling all other functions in accordance with it.
You will play an integral role in shaping the company's strategic direction and realizing its potential.Who we are looking for:
A hands-on PM who wants responsibility at the product and platform level, not just the feature/functional level
Someone that can toggle between/balance business/market needs and product/technology details
Someone that loves working in an agile manner - adjusting course based on new information is something you understand as an inevitability, not something to resist
Someone that loves to interact with customers and prospects to both tell our story and uncover unmet needs
A Product Owner who is responsible for driving near-to-long-term product backlog priorities, ensuring that the engineering team has the information, context, and details needed to create the best platform experience possible
A hands-on, technical product manager with a solid technology background who is looking to go deep in a technology area, speak to the details and hold down technical conversations with engineers and highly technical customers
A colleague who wants to collaborate with his/her peers across the company, pitch in as needed, and share in the broader team's success
A speaker, writer, and translator fluent in the languages of customers and their requirements, effectively communicating them at the appropriate level to other functional areas like engineering, marketing, sales, finance and customer success
Someone that has been a PM in the enterprise SaaS context, and preferably has a cybersecurity background
Requirements:
3-5 years of experience in enterprise SaaS, preferably with focus on cybersecurity, or related areas
3+ years of relevant product management experience, both inbound and outbound
A bachelor's or master's degree in CS (or related discipline)Experience building and evangelizing SaaS solutions in both federal and commercial spaces would be a strong plus
Ability to present effectively to large audiences, keynotes, webinars
Demonstrated ability to execute on a vision and strategy, with a proven track record of delivering market-leading solutions and developing new products with commercial success
Ability to own/maintain/run demos and enable go-to-market teams
Cloud and/or cyber security domain expertise - good understanding of enterprise IT infrastructure and cloud domains
Experience working with MSPs (Managed Service Providers) or MSSPs (Managed Security Service Providers) is a plus
Experience with SaaS Business Models, especially as it relates to transactional, usage-based business models, is a plus
Compensation:
$150,000 - $190,000 (location and experience based) + bonus & equity
